Jerry Jones Leaves NJ Governor Chris Christie Hanging After Cowboys’ Game-Winning Fumble

Late in the fourth quarter, after DeMarcus Lawrence’s game-winning sack fumble against the Detroit Lions, New Jersey governor and 2016 presidential hopeful Chris Christie put up both hands to give Cowboys’ owner Jerry Jones a high five. Jones left him hanging and Christie had to settle with this awkward bro hug.
